Mamá''s Panza

English

By (author): Isabel Quintero

Illustrated by: Iliana Galvez

Everyone has a panza - it can be big and round, soft and small, or somewhere in between. But a young boys favourite panza of all is Mamás. Her panza is capable of remarkable things, and she loves it as an important part of herself. Her panza was also his first home. Even before he was born, it cradled and held him. When hes feeling shy and needs a place to hide or when he wants somewhere to rest during a bedtime story, Mamás panza is always there. With affirming text by Isabel Quintero and vivid art by Iliana Galvez, Mamás Panza is a young boys love letter to his mother, along with a celebration of our bodies and our bellies. See more

About Isabel Quintero

Isabel Quintero is an award-winning writer and the daughter of Mexican immigrants. Gabi A Girl in Pieces her first YA novel was the recipient of multiple awards including the Tomás Rivera Award the California Book Award Gold Medal and the Morris Award for Debut YA Novel. She is also the author of chapter books and a non-fiction YA graphic biography Photographic: The Life of Graciela Iturbide which was awarded the Boston Globe Horn Book Award. Most recently My Papi Has a Motorcycle earned the Southern California Independent Booksellers Association Award the Pura Belpré Illustration Honor Award the Tomás Rivera Mexican American Childrens Book Award and many other recognitions.Iliana Galvez is a queer Latinx illustrator mother and pug whisperer born and raised in the San Fernando Valley who is currently based in Houston. She started her Instagram page @GrowMija as a love letter to her baby sister Chachis to show her art that looked like her and to let her know how amazing she is.
